This study investigated the impact of AI-driven tools on English language learning, motivated by the increasing integration of artificial intelligence in education and the need for empirical evidence on its effectiveness. The purpose of the study was to explore how AI-driven tools personalize learning, provide instant feedback, and affect learner perceptions. Using a quantitative research design, data were collected from 200 students across four international schools via questionnaires. Three major findings emerged: AI-driven tools significantly enhanced personalized learning experiences, with 72.5% of students rating personalization highly; instant feedback from AI tools was found to be very helpful by 80% of students, leading to improved language acquisition progress; and 80% of students recommended AI-driven tools, citing increased enjoyment and engagement. The study concluded that AI-driven tools effectively support personalized learning and provide beneficial instant feedback, though challenges such as technical issues and the need for human interaction remain. It was recommended that educators integrate AI tools thoughtfully, ensuring a balance with traditional methods and addressing technical and accessibility concerns. Further research should investigate long-term impacts and optimal implementation strategies.
